For family that will be flying in, flying into the local Rhode Island T.F Green International Airport (PVD) may be more challenging and expensive due to its limited flight service. You may find it easier and cheaper to fly into Boston’s Logan International Airport (BOS) and renting a car from there. Many rental services are provided at Logan such as Enterprise, Avis, Budget, Alamo and Hertz. The drive from the airport to Warwick, RI is about an hour on average and very straight forward (after you leave Boston that is 😅).
For guests traveling by train, the closest station is Providence Station, served by Amtrak and the MBTA Commuter Rail (from Boston’s South Station). Once you arrive in Providence, the wedding venue in Warwick is approximately a 25-30 minute drive. Taxis, Uber, and Lyft are readily available outside the station for easy transportation to your hotel or directly to the venue. For guests coming from Boston, the MBTA Commuter Rail offers a convenient and affordable option, while Amtrak provides faster service for those traveling from New York, the DMV area, or further.
For guests traveling by car, Warwick, Rhode Island is easily accessible via major highways. From Boston, MA: Approximately a 1 hour to 1 hour 30 minute drive, depending on traffic, via I-95 South. From Connecticut: Approximately a 1.5 to 2 hour drive, depending on your starting location, via I-95 North. From New York, NY: Approximately a 3 to 4 hour drive, depending on traffic, via I-95 North. From Virginia (DMV Area): Approximately a 6 to 8 hour drive, depending on your starting point, via I-95 North. Please note that traffic can vary, so we recommend allowing extra travel time.
